A LUT (.cube file) is a universal color lookup table that works in any NLE — Premiere Pro, Final Cut Pro, VN, CapCut, and more. A PowerGrade (.drp) is a multi-node grading system exclusive to DaVinci Resolve that gives you per-node control over each stage of the grade.
It depends on the product. LUTs work in any editor that supports .cube files. PowerGrades require DaVinci Resolve 17 or later. Lightroom presets need Adobe Lightroom Classic or CC. Film grain overlays work in any video editor that supports compositing layers. Sound effects are standard WAV files.
All grain overlays and texture files are 4K resolution in ProRes 4444 format with alpha channel support. They can be used in any project resolution from HD to 4K+.
